- 在线时间
- 1957 小时
- 最后登录
- 2024-6-29
- 注册时间
- 2004-4-26
- 听众数
- 49
- 收听数
- 0
- 能力
- 60 分
- 体力
- 40959 点
- 威望
- 6 点
- 阅读权限
- 255
- 积分
- 23862
- 相册
- 0
- 日志
- 0
- 记录
- 0
- 帖子
- 20501
- 主题
- 18182
- 精华
- 5
- 分享
- 0
- 好友
- 140
TA的每日心情 | 奋斗 2024-6-23 05:14 |
|---|
签到天数: 1043 天 [LV.10]以坛为家III
 群组: 万里江山 群组: sas讨论小组 群组: 长盛证券理财有限公司 群组: C 语言讨论组 群组: Matlab讨论组 |
< >void __fastcall TForm1::Button1Click(TObject *Sender)
: W. e5 o0 e* \ J{9 @1 L7 B$ [* M; s8 [
DWORD TheProcessID, ErrorCode;# u. h) ^, }2 g3 M& r
HWND TheWindowHandle=FindWindowEx(NULL,NULL,"IEFrame",NULL);
# F0 b1 w* w7 _2 h1 V0 {//找IE窗口
4 e$ g$ t9 x3 ~5 x if(TheWindowHandle)
5 e0 }$ r+ M5 Q @+ [# T a {! E& w, k6 P! F
GetWindowThreadProcessId(TheWindowHandle,&TheProcessID);9 U& O# l8 Z: ^( V- S
//有的话,获取进程ID
$ y/ s6 F6 k2 B% f0 B5 D HANDLE TheProcessHandle=OpenProcess(PROCESS_TERMINATE,false,TheProcessID);
& h9 j7 q5 l/ |) c4 q TerminateProcess(TheProcessHandle, 0);
+ G7 e, [' j5 h$ o" |) B- A//杀掉
r, \& q* {5 _/ x9 E }! l2 g6 N a5 O, T+ u- }6 ]9 C
else
! D" R+ @1 c/ Q7 m Application->MessageBox("There's no Internet Explorer window","ERROR",1);</P>2 p7 C5 J' I6 Y& J. B. b- B
< >}
$ R" D$ C b' s& `' I4 x//---------------------------------------------------------------------------</P>, w4 e2 h' }. r" T3 c
< >void __fastcall TForm1::Button2Click(TObject *Sender)! N5 c, J- C; m
{
8 y( T2 J1 V7 @0 }3 l) ?7 j: L HWND TheWindowHandle= FindWindow("Tapplication", " roject1");' e8 d6 s; r& X. S+ T S
if(TheWindowHandle)//有的话就关掉8 `) C! _3 e; J
PostMessage(TheWindowHandle, WM_QUIT, 0, 0 );7 p! l# y( m2 [7 ~/ f) G, i
}</P> |
zan
|